Oracle
De Oracle-database is een volwaardig, compleet en soms complex, Relationeel DataBase Management Systeem (RDBMS). In dit WikiBook staan de concepten en processen beschreven die tezamen het Oracle RDBMS vormen of anders gezegd de Oracle Database Server.
Op het moment is Oracle nu bij versie 11gR2 van hun databaseserver.
De Oracle Database Server draait op een groot aantal verschillende besturingssystemen, waaronder Unix, Linux, Solaris, Mac OS X en Windows.
Onlangs heeft Oracle een eigen Linuxdistributie uitgebracht, namelijk Unbreakable Linux. Dit is gebaseerd op de broncode van Redhat. De werking van de Oracle Database Server is op alle platformen in wezen hetzelfde, alleen onder het Windows-besturingssysteem zijn de processen wat meer afgeschermd.
De Database Server valt te verdelen in enkele hoofdgebieden :
Databasestructuren
[bewerken]Een Oracle-database bestaat uit een aantal fysieke bestanden. Intern werkt Oracle met blokken of groepen van blokken. Het merendeel van de fysieke bestanden bestaan uit een aaneenschakeling van logische blokken. Deze blokken zijn te groeperen in andere logische eenheden zoals uitbreidingen meer gedetailleerd en onderdelen. Op verschillende niveaus kan bepaald worden hoe deze logische blokken ingedeeld moeten worden en kan bijvoorbeeld het groei-gedrag aangegeven worden.
- Zie verder Oracle/Database structuren
Geheugengebieden
[bewerken]De System Global Area (SGA) of soms ook Shared Global Area van een Oracle-database is het geheugengebied op de server dat gebruikt wordt door de verschillende Oracle-processen. De SGA is onder te verdelen in verschillende gebieden.
- Zie verder Oracle/Geheugengebieden
Databaseprocessen
[bewerken]Waneer een Oracle-instantie gestart wordt, worden er ook een aantal background-processen gestart waarvan vier verplichte processen.
- Zie verder Oracle/Database_processen
Dit boek is in opstartfase: het boek is weinig uitgebreid, en de tekst bevat wellicht nog fouten.
U wordt uitgenodigd aan dit boek mee te werken! Dat kan bijvoorbeeld op de volgende manieren:
|